A automação de processos robóticos (RPA) vem transformando a eficiência das empresas, e, por isso, contar com um bom software RPA é essencial para iniciativas de automação.
Entretanto, com a disseminação de diversas ferramentas de RPA e frameworks de automação, as empresas enfrentam o desafio de orquestrar automações de forma eficaz.
Neste contexto, a arquitetura multi-vendor em RPA surge como uma abordagem estratégica. Cada vez mais, empresas combinam as capacidades de diferentes sistemas RPA, como soluções low-code e também high-code para aumentar a performance e criar uma cultura de hiperautomação.
Neste artigo, vamos explorar a fundo os tipos de software RPA, suas principais funcionalidades, principais plataformas RPA e critérios para contratá-las.
O que é software RPA?
Software RPA é uma plataforma utilizada para criação, monitoramento e orquestração de automações em robotic process automation (RPA). Ferramentas RPA ajudam equipes diversas a reduzir erros humanos e aumentar a eficiência operacional.
Esses softwares executam processos de maneira rápida e precisa. Sua aplicação se estende por diversos setores, desde TI, finanças e recursos humanos até atendimento ao cliente.
Tipos de software RPA
Com a evolução da tecnologia RPA, surgiram diferentes tipos de softwares, cada um adequado a necessidades específicas das empresas. Confira:
RPA low-code
Os softwares de RPA low-code destacam-se pela sua interface intuitiva e facilidade de uso.
Eles permitem que profissionais sem amplo conhecimento técnico em programação ou citizen developers possam criar e implementar bots de automação.
Estes softwares são ideais para empresas que não possuem equipes técnicas ou parceiros para criar automações em código e precisam habilitar desde times de RPA até equipes de negócio.
RPA high-code
Em contrapartida, os softwares RPA high-code são projetados para desenvolvedores RPA com conhecimentos em programação. Eles oferecem maior flexibilidade e capacidade de personalização, tornando-se a escolha ideal para automação de processos mais complexos e específicos.
Este tipo de ferramenta é ideal para empresas que já possuem iniciativas de RPA estruturadas e precisam de maior autonomia e custo-benefício para escalar suas automações.
Saiba mais: Comparação entre Python RPA vs. Low Code
Principais funcionalidades de um software RPA
Um orquestrador RPA é um componente crítico no gerenciamento e escalabilidade de bots de automação. As principais funcionalidades incluem:
- Gerenciamento de implantação de bots: permite atualizar e manter os bots de maneira eficaz;
- Gestão de tarefas: organiza e prioriza as tarefas executadas pelos bots;
- Sistema de agendamento: facilita a programação de tarefas para execução automática;
- Alertas: notifica os usuários sobre eventos ou exceções;
- Gestão de erros: identifica e trata falhas no processo de automação;
- Gestão de credenciais: administra as credenciais de forma segura;
- Reports e analytics: fornece análises e relatórios detalhados para avaliar a eficácia das automações;
- Grupos de usuários: permite definir níveis de acesso e as permissões dos usuários.
Saiba mais: Iceberg do RPA: os desafios vão além da automação
7 softwares de RPA para conhecer
A escolha do software RPA adequado é determinante para o sucesso da sua iniciativa RPA. Seu arsenal de automação deve ser compatível com a maturidade da sua empresa em RPA, habilidades do seu time e, é claro, com o seu orçamento.
Abaixo, você confere algumas das ferramentas de RPA mais renomadas do mercado e suas particularidades.
UiPath
A UiPath oferece uma plataforma low-code abrangente para automação. Os usuários encontram ferramentas para mineração de processos, assistentes virtuais e gestão de ações.
A UiPath disponibiliza robôs automatizados poderosos, incluindo robôs atendidos, robôs de nuvem com capacidades SaaS e robôs não atendidos para fluxos de trabalho longos e intensos. Sua desvantagem é o custo, que pode ser inviável à medida em que a empresa aumenta o volume de automações.
Automation Anywhere
A Automation Anywhere oferece ferramentas de descoberta de processos e desenvolvimento de bots, em uma plataforma de automação 360 graus. A plataforma é 100% baseada na web, facilitando a automação sem conhecimento extensivo de codificação.
BotCity
A BotCity se destaca pela sua flexibilidade em soluções de RPA high-code , permitindo uma personalização mais profunda em comparação com plataformas low-code, além de automações mais leves e com velocidade até 15 vezes maior. Com foco em programação Python RPA, a BotCity é ideal para empresas que buscam uma maior autonomia e controle sobre processos complexos que exigem uma integração mais profunda com sistemas existentes.
Blue Prism
A Blue Prism oferece soluções de automação inteligente alimentadas por IA e machine learning. Sua plataforma inclui um criador de UX para desenvolvimento de fluxos de trabalho personalizados e um ecossistema de ferramentas para monitoramento e otimização remota.
Power Automate
Com uma abordagem low-code, o Power Automate é uma ferramenta de automação que permite aos usuários criar fluxos de trabalho automatizados entre vários aplicativos e serviços. É conhecido pela sua integração perfeita com outros produtos da Microsoft, como o Office 365 e o Dynamics 365.
Appian
A Appian fornece soluções de automação para todas as indústrias, combinando automação de processos inteligentes e mineração de processos. Sua tecnologia de construção low-code facilita a criação de bots e soluções RPA.
AkaBot
Especializada em soluções de hiperautomação e RPA, o AkaBot facilita a implementação rápida de automação com o AkaBot Studio e o AkaBot Agent para criação de assistentes virtuais. O AkaBot Center permite o monitoramento e controle unificado de todos os bots RPA.
Cada um desses softwares possui vantagens únicas, como facilidade de uso, flexibilidade, capacidades avançadas de IA e ML, e suporte para uma variedade de casos de uso.
No entanto, considere suas necessidades específicas e capacidades técnicas ao escolher um software RPA. A seguir, vamos explorar os critérios para contratar uma ferramenta RPA.
Saiba mais: Migrando de low-code para Python RPA
O que considerar na hora de contratar um software RPA
Ao selecionar um software RPA, é importante considerar diversos fatores para garantir que a escolha atenda às necessidades e objetivos da empresa. Confira, abaixo, alguns deles:
Escalabilidade
A capacidade do software de se adaptar ao crescimento e às mudanças da empresa é fundamental. Um bom software RPA deve ser capaz de escalar de acordo com a demanda, sem perder eficiência.
Performance
Avaliar a eficiência e a velocidade com que o software executa as tarefas automatizadas é crucial. Softwares com alta performance garantem um fluxo de trabalho mais ágil e eficiente.
Custo
O custo do software deve ser considerado em relação ao retorno sobre o investimento (ROI) que ele pode proporcionar. É importante avaliar não só o custo inicial, mas também os custos de manutenção e escalabilidade a longo prazo.
Governança
A capacidade do software de fornecer controles robustos e eficientes para a gestão dos processos automatizados é vital. Uma boa governança garante que as automações estejam alinhadas com as políticas e os procedimentos da empresa.
Dependência e lock-in
É essencial avaliar o nível de dependência que a empresa terá em relação ao software e se há flexibilidade para mudanças futuras ou integração com outros sistemas.
Capacidade de integração
A habilidade do software de se integrar com outros sistemas e tecnologias é um aspecto crucial, principalmente em ambientes corporativos complexos, onde diferentes sistemas precisam trabalhar de forma harmoniosa.
Saiba mais: Mudança no Perfil das Equipes de RPA
Sua equipe precisa de um software RPA robusto?
A escolha das ferramentas de RPA certas, considerando fatores como escalabilidade, performance, custo, governança, dependência e capacidade de integração, é crucial para maximizar os benefícios da automação robótica de processos.
A arquitetura multi-vendor em RPA representa um marco na jornada de automação das empresas, oferecendo uma abordagem mais versátil e adaptável.
Para empresas que buscam explorar as vantagens dessa arquitetura contando com uma solução que oferece flexibilidade, escalabilidade e capacidade técnica avançada, a BotCity é uma escolha sólida.
Nosso orquestrador oferece ferramentas avançadas para criar fluxos de trabalho altamente personalizados. Além disso, o uso de Python como linguagem de automação fornece um alto grau de flexibilidade. Ademais, oferece opções de licenciamento acessíveis, tornando-o uma escolha econômica para empresas de todos os tamanhos.
Agende uma conversa com nossos especialistas ou, se quiser experimentar o BotCity por conta própria, sinta-se à vontade para criar uma conta gratuita!